login  Naam:   Wachtwoord: 
Registreer je!
 Forum

Image caching

Offline Drieske - 26/03/2010 18:49
Avatar van DrieskeLid Ik ben een test aan het ontwikkelen waar er elke keer zo een 26tal afbeeldingen moet worden geladen, nu heb ik bij de uitleg over de test de afbeeldingen pregeload met de volgende code :

  1. foreach (ListFiles("./data/img") as $key=>$file){
  2. echo "<img style=\"display:none;\" src=\"".$file."\" />";
  3. }


Dit werkt in FF & chrome maar het lijkt dat IE elke keer de afbeeldingen opnieuw moet laten, hoe komt dit? Is er een manier waarop ik de afbeeldingen kan cachen en deze niet opnieuw worden geladen in elke browser?

Mvg,
Dries

2 antwoorden

Gesponsorde links
Offline Martijn - 27/03/2010 13:55
Avatar van Martijn Crew PHP ja moet een htaccess bestand aanmaken en daarin een cachetijd aangeven:

  1. # 480 weeks
  2. <FilesMatch "\.(jpg|jpeg|png|gif)$">
  3. Header set Cache-Control "max-age=290304000, public"
  4. </FilesMatch>
Offline Drieske - 28/03/2010 13:48
Avatar van Drieske Lid Bedankt, heb dit geprobeerd maar in IE blijven de afbeeldingen stuk voor stuk komen, hoe komt dit? In FF & chrome is het goed, kijkt u zelf maar :

http://axonet.be/projects/yzebaert/test.php
Gesponsorde links
Dit onderwerp is gesloten.
Actieve forumberichten
© 2002-2024 Sitemasters.be - Regels - Laadtijd: 0.186s